Skip to content

Commit b58b9b8

Browse files
authored
fix: metadata has wrong ec version (#701)
* fix: metadata has wrong versions in it * f * f * f
1 parent b911508 commit b58b9b8

File tree

3 files changed

+9
-1
lines changed

3 files changed

+9
-1
lines changed

.github/workflows/pull-request.yaml

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-67,6 +67,7 @@ jobs:
6767
export LOCAL_ARTIFACT_MIRROR_IMAGE=registry.staging.replicated.com/library/embedded-cluster-local-artifact-mirror
6868
make build-and-push-local-artifact-mirror-image VERSION="${SHORT_SHA}"
6969
make build-and-push-local-artifact-mirror-image VERSION="${SHORT_SHA}-previous-k0s"
70+
make build-and-push-local-artifact-mirror-image VERSION="${SHORT_SHA}-upgrade"
7071
7172
- name: Build Linux AMD64 and Output Metadata
7273
run: |
@@ -75,6 +76,9 @@ jobs:
7576
make -B embedded-cluster-linux-amd64 K0S_VERSION=$(make print-PREVIOUS_K0S_VERSION) VERSION="${SHORT_SHA}-previous-k0s"
7677
tar -C output/bin -czvf embedded-cluster-linux-amd64-previous-k0s.tgz embedded-cluster
7778
./output/bin/embedded-cluster version metadata > metadata-previous-k0s.json
79+
make -B embedded-cluster-linux-amd64 VERSION="${SHORT_SHA}-upgrade"
80+
tar -C output/bin -czvf embedded-cluster-linux-amd64-upgrade.tgz embedded-cluster
81+
./output/bin/embedded-cluster version metadata > metadata-upgrade.json
7882
make -B embedded-cluster-linux-amd64 VERSION="${SHORT_SHA}"
7983
tar -C output/bin -czvf embedded-cluster-linux-amd64.tgz embedded-cluster
8084
./output/bin/embedded-cluster version metadata > metadata.json

.github/workflows/release-dev.yaml

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-34,6 +34,7 @@ jobs:
3434
export LOCAL_ARTIFACT_MIRROR_IMAGE=registry.staging.replicated.com/library/embedded-cluster-local-artifact-mirror
3535
make build-and-push-local-artifact-mirror-image VERSION="${SHORT_SHA}"
3636
make build-and-push-local-artifact-mirror-image VERSION="${SHORT_SHA}-previous-k0s"
37+
make build-and-push-local-artifact-mirror-image VERSION="${SHORT_SHA}-upgrade"
3738
3839
- name: Build Linux AMD64 and Output Metadata
3940
run: |
@@ -42,6 +43,9 @@ jobs:
4243
make -B embedded-cluster-linux-amd64 K0S_VERSION=$(make print-PREVIOUS_K0S_VERSION) VERSION="${SHORT_SHA}-previous-k0s"
4344
tar -C output/bin -czvf embedded-cluster-linux-amd64-previous-k0s.tgz embedded-cluster
4445
./output/bin/embedded-cluster version metadata > metadata-previous-k0s.json
46+
make -B embedded-cluster-linux-amd64 VERSION="${SHORT_SHA}-upgrade"
47+
tar -C output/bin -czvf embedded-cluster-linux-amd64-upgrade.tgz embedded-cluster
48+
./output/bin/embedded-cluster version metadata > metadata-upgrade.json
4549
make -B embedded-cluster-linux-amd64 VERSION="${SHORT_SHA}"
4650
tar -C output/bin -czvf embedded-cluster-linux-amd64.tgz embedded-cluster
4751
./output/bin/embedded-cluster version metadata > metadata.json

scripts/create-upgrade-release.sh

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-44,7 +44,7 @@ function metadata() {
4444
if [ -f metadata.json ]; then
4545
sudo apt-get install jq -y
4646

47-
jq '(.Configs.charts[] | select(.name == "embedded-cluster-operator")).values += "resources:\n requests:\n cpu: 123m"' metadata.json > upgrade-metadata.json
47+
jq '(.Configs.charts[] | select(.name == "embedded-cluster-operator")).values += "resources:\n requests:\n cpu: 123m"' metadata-upgrade.json > upgrade-metadata.json
4848
cat upgrade-metadata.json
4949

5050
retry 3 aws s3 cp upgrade-metadata.json "s3://${S3_BUCKET}/metadata/${EC_VERSION}.json"

0 commit comments

Comments
 (0)